And not just that, there are many pinoys who are excellent in building, designing clothes and shoes, animations, furniture makers, photography, etc. We are showing the world how great and talented Filipinos are.

Where to find them on SL? They are everywhere! Some Pinoys even have their sims opened up for ''Tambayan'' (hang out) like Sayawan Paradise, L's Dance Club and others. Some are busy shop owners, others are having a good time partying at clubs. Then, there are some who you can watch on ramp, showing off their skills in modeling and others are gathered up doing 'kwentuhan' (chatting) on some friend's home. Send an IM on a Filipino group and you'll get a warm welcome from everyone. But then again, not everyone goes partying of course. There are also those who come to SL to learn. Some attend english classes to be able to learn the language well and speak it fluently with voice discussion exercises.

To name some successful pinoys in SL, there is Shai Delacroix, an excellent clothes designer who showcases our very own Terno and Barong Tagalog. The owner of Maldita Animation, Modesta Heying, best selling AOs in SL. Kabalyero Kidd and his 3 stars and a Sun and his famous fishing rods. Lora Hennesy, who might be living in Germany but very much proud Pinoy, owner of L's Dance Club, one of the longest running club in SL. Imlon Galicia, a brilliant prefab builder, you can find his works anywhere on the grid. Alette Gears, one of the first Filipino shoe makers in SL, sells affordable and pretty shoes. Lucretia Svenska, a furniture builder who designs low prim and quality furnitures. Macy Arida, owner of a MA Modeling Agency. And a lot more whom I will be featuring on this blog!
